i returned an item to a seller who claims to have not received it. No tracking is available. The seller is not issueing a refund and has opened a case. eBay has found in his favour and closed the case. No refund is forthcoming. I also don't appear able to leave feedback for the seller. How is this possible?
When you return items then you have to do it through the resolution centre
You have to have tracking to prove it was Delivered or ATtempted delivery to the seller
No trackin and you lose any dispute. There is nothing you can do
Sellers cannot "open a case".
You should have opened a "not as described case" and seller would have sent a label with tracking. Did you do that or have you simply returned it by some d-i-y method.
If tracking to him is not available I very very much doubt you will get anywhere and - if you do not use the eBay system - they will not be interested
